An Early Termination Scheme For Successive Cancellation List Decoding Of Polar Codes

Huang-Chang Lee, Yu-Sheng Pao, Cheng-Yi Chi, Hsin-Yu Lee, Yeong-Luh Ueng

In order to minimize the decoding period and the response time for Polar Codes, an early termination (ET) scheme based on additional check points (ACPs) is proposed in this work. For conventional ET schemes based on distributed parity-check (PC) bits, ET can only be triggered when the decoding process reaches the PC bits. The ACPs are selected from the information bits, and extend the feature of the PC bits, where ET can also be triggered at the ACPs, meaning that a more rapid ET is available that does not impact the error-rate performance. With sophisticated method of selecting ACPs based on the channel-independent polarization weight (PW), the proposed ET scheme is able to reduce the response time by about 5% to 20% on average compared to previous works.
